2 Stabbed at Club in Opa-locka

Victims in stable condition as police investigate incident at Klub 24

Published on Mar. 2, 2026

Two people were stabbed early Sunday morning at a club in Opa-locka, Florida. Police responded to reports of the incident at around 4:05 a.m. at Klub 24, where they found the two victims. The victims were treated by first responders and are currently in stable condition. No arrests have been made as the investigation remains ongoing.

The details

According to the Opa-locka Police Department, officers responded to reports of a stabbing at Klub 24, a nightclub located at 3699 NW 135th St. in Opa-locka. Upon arrival, they found two victims who had been stabbed. The victims were treated by first responders and are currently in stable condition. No arrests have been made, and the investigation into the incident remains active.

  • The incident occurred around 4:05 a.m. on Sunday, March 1, 2026.
